How source code is handled

Learn what CodeValuation.com reads, what it stores, and what happens when GitHub is disconnected.

Updated July 20, 2026 · Revision 1

Public repositories are evaluated from public GitHub data. Private repositories require an authorized GitHub App installation.

Private source is processed in an ephemeral environment. CodeValuation.com persists permitted identifiers, hashes, derived measurements, valuation snapshots, and evidence references, but not a copy of the source code.

Disconnecting GitHub stops private scans, cancels queued private work, invalidates private report access, and begins the configured deletion window for inaccessible private-derived data.
